Everyone (all team members) should arrive in 38-500 at noon. When you arrive, we will first ask you to
return the Eden and wireless card
pay for replacement/broken parts (if we asked you to do so at impounding)
fill out a course feedback survey
Clean up should last about two hours if everyone works efficiently. We need to pack all the Maslab equipment into storage, replace the scopes and power supplies in the shop, and generally clean up the lab (so future years will be allowed to use the space).

Wrap Up
Final Papers are due by midnight, Feb. 1. Check FinalPaperGuidelines for details.
Don't forget to complete your daily wiki entries.
If a team fails to complete their daily wiki entries, final paper, or design review presentation, the best grade they can receive is a D, regardless of how well their robot performs.
A team that does not return the compute and wireless card and/or does not pay for replacement parts will not receive a passing grade.
